The cable is expensive, but considering most tethered-only PC headsets are still more expensive than the Quest 2 with the cable, it comes out ahead in value even after adding the accessory. The $79 Link Cable is a five-meter USB-C cord that lets you connect the Quest 2 to your computer and use it just like the Rift S to play PC-specific VR games like Half-Life: Alyx. The Quest 2 can be used as a tethered headset if you buy the right accessory (and have a powerful PC). It's powered by mobile components, specifically the Qualcomm Snapdragon 865 chipset, and that's enough to run compelling VR experiences. It's still inexpensive for a VR platform, though, and you don't need any additional hardware attached or cables running out of the headset. The Meta Quest 2 (formerly the Oculus Quest 2) is a $300 standalone VR headset as of June 4 Meta bumped the price by $100 last year, but has since cut it back down with the announcement of the upcoming Meta Quest 3. Although Facebook bought Oculus and has been phasing the name out in favor of Meta for both its VR platform and the entire company's name, the Oculus roots run deep. The Oculus Rift was the first big name in the current VR wave, arguably because it made VR remotely affordable.
